EditAutomattic Inc. is a technology company that operates in the digital content and software market. The company is primarily known for its development and management of WordPress.com, a popular platform used for creating websites and blogs. Automattic's mission is to make the web a better place, and it does this by providing a range of tools and services for online content creation and management.
The company's primary clients are individuals, businesses, and organizations that need a platform to create and manage their online presence. This includes bloggers, small businesses, large corporations, and non-profit organizations. Automattic's services are used by podcasters, job recruiters, and anyone who needs a platform to share their story or services online.
Automattic operates on a freemium business model. This means that while it offers basic services for free, it also provides premium services for a fee. These premium services include advanced design customization, additional storage space, and business-specific features. The company also generates revenue through advertising on the free version of WordPress.com.
In addition to WordPress.com, Automattic also contributes to a number of non-profit and open source projects. This includes the development of mobile applications for iOS and Android, which allow users to manage their WordPress sites on the go.
In summary, Automattic is a technology company that provides online content creation and management tools. It serves a wide range of clients, operates in the digital content and software market, and generates revenue through a freemium business model and advertising.
